">What is a QA Engineer?
">A QA engineer, also known as a quality assurance engineer, is a professional responsible for ensuring that software applications meet the required standards of quality, reliability, and functionality. They play a crucial role in the development process by identifying and reporting defects, and collaborating with developers to resolve issues.
">Professional Requirements
">To become a QA engineer, one typically needs a bachelor's degree in computer science, software engineering, or a related field.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ills are essential for this role.
">Recommended Accreditations and Certifications
">While not mandatory, certifications like ISTQB (International Software Testing Qualifications Board) or CSTE (Certified Software Test Engineer) can demonstrate expertise and commitment to the profession.

Average Prices for QA Engineer Services in Vancouver
">The average daily fee for a QA engineer in Vancouver, Canada, can range from $500 to $1,500 CAD, depending on the project's complexity, the engineer's experience, and the specific requirements of the client.
">For instance, in Vancouver, the average daily fee for a QA engineer can be around $750 CAD, while in other major cities in Canada, such as Toronto or Montreal, the average daily fee can range from $600 to $1,200 CAD.
">It's essential to note that these prices are estimates and can vary depending on the specific project requirements and the QA engineer's level of expertise.
